Across TCGA patient cohorts, PLXNB2 RNA expression is significantly associated with the protein abundance of many other proteins, with 9,082 significant associations in total. GBM sh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ible PLXNB2-associated proteins across cancer lineages are PACSIN2, TRIOBP, and TRIP6. Each is linked with PLXNB2 in more than 5 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both PLXNB2-to-partner and partner-to-PLXNB2 results are reported.
